1hour decant(some chunky/fine sediment). A striking still dark magenta color with little bricking. On the nose: Inviting notes of sweet red/blue fruit, smoked meat, floral, worn leather, nutmeg, wet forest floor. Taste: velvety, smooth, elegant, savory mature wine with dried cherries, cocoa, leather, scorched earth, and a minerally mocha long lingering finish. YUM!! — 4 months ago

This is classic JP Quarter Moon.
The 18 has nice evolution while holding its vineyard characters. It shows medium dark fruits; black cherries, blackberries, strawberries, nicely layered spice & baking spices, mid red flowers, excellent acidity and a finish that is elegant, well balanced-knitted and lasts 90 seconds.

1 hour decant(lots of sediment). A gorgeous purplish garnet color. On the nose: Intoxicating musky notes of dark fruit, potting soil, worn leather, truffles, stewed meat, slight menthol. Taste: velvety, seamless, balanced, intense wine with dark fruit, cassis, earth, tobacco, mineral, herbs, and a chocolate graphite long never-ending finish. YUM! This wine has aged gracefully and has more gas in the tank. Enjoy. — 2 months ago
